#c4b9f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4b9f2 is composed of 76.9% red, 72.5%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19% cyan, 23.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 251.6 degrees, a saturation of 68.7% and a lightness of 83.7%. #c4b9f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8973e5.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#c4b9f2 color description : Very soft blue.
#c4b9f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4b9f2 has RGB values of R:196, G:185,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 12892658.
